The Deputy Chief Medical Officer (DCMO) is responsible for assisting the Chief Medical Officer (CMO) and working collaboratively with other DCMOs in the oversight and management of all clinical functions as well as promoting the organizational vision. The DCMO will support the CMO with the integrations of medical, academic, specialty, and other related service lines as well as work in a cross-functional collegial and collaborative manner with other executives and staff. The DCMO will have accountability/ownership and responsibility to lead and manage a number of medical directors and staff providers, (physicians, physician assistants, nurse practitioners, other).
As a Staff Physician, the DCMO will examine and treat common acute illnesses, injuries, accidents and other injuries and illnesses, perform most medical services routinely handled within the scope of the physician’s practice and which the staff physician is competent to perform. Perform selected laboratory testing, refer to specialists as needed, write prescriptions, and perform office procedures within the scope of expertise, protocols, and available equipment. This physician executive will maintain an FTE status of 0.4 managing administrative duties and the remaining FTE will be balanced with direct clinical care.
R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Assist the CMO and collaborate with the other DCMO with direction and oversight of all daily aspects of the clinical functions of the organization.
- In the absence of the CMO, the DCMOs will oversee all service lines.
- Recommend strategies to enhance clinical performance, effectiveness, efficiencies, productivity, and compliance.
- Monitor, recommend and revise clinical policies and procedures related to everyday functioning of the primary care service line.
- Manage needs for privilege and proctoring of new provider staff as needed.
- Assist with ensuring clinical compliance with the FQHC program requirements.
- Provide the CMO support with the direction of empanelment.
- Provide the CMO support with system wide oversight of medical directors by providing clarity, and direction and removing obstacles that may impede the medical director’s success.
- Support the CMO with pilot initiatives of the organization.
- Expansion and support of where leadership is needed that is outside of an area medical director, e.g. the overseeing spread of successful pilot initiatives.
- Support the ongoing provider recruitment and retention efforts at STRIDE.
- Support the ongoing leadership development of the team of medical directors and others.
- Using signal data, identifying, and supporting providers in need of support with EMR training, retraining, and STRIDE procedures to offload providers.
- Performs other related duties as assigned by the CEO, CMO, and Executive Leadership.
